Kabul: Cash Aid Provided to Family Who Lost Four Members in Recent Snowfall
Monday, January 26, 2026
General President of the ARCS, Sheikh-ul-Hadith Shahabuddin Delawar, provided cash assistance of 50,000 Afghanis at the central headquarters to the head of a family from Kabul’s 12th district. The family lost four members when their home collapsed due to heavy snowfall several days ago.
During the handover, Mr. Delawar expressed his condolences to the family head and assured them that the ARCS stands by them during this difficult time. He also stated that the ARCS plans to provide cash aid soon to 21 other families in Khost, Kandahar, Maidan Wardak, Parwan, and Ghor provinces who also lost family members due to recent snowfall.
It is worth noting that ARCS rescue teams arrived promptly after the incident, transported the injured to the hospital, and, at the request of the family head, transferred the deceased to their ancestral home in Nangarhar.
